Apollo reviewed House of Many Ways by Diana Wynne Jones (Howl's Moving Castle, #3)
A Return to Form
3 stars
This third novel is definitely a return to form after the disappointing second book in the series. One of the antagonists was surprisingly, genuinely terrifying, and felt a bit out of step with the rest of the book. The book doesn't quite recapture the magic of Howl's Moving Castle, but there are sections where it delivers fun adventure.
